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best Dog Food for Sensitive Puppy Stomachs
Choosing the right food for a sensitive puppy is a technical process that involves understanding ingredients, digestibility, and breed-specific needs. Buyers often face tradeoffs between protein sources, bag sizes, and food formats. Many assume all "sensitive" formulas are the same, but real differences exist in protein type, fiber content, and packaging.
- Dry vs. Wet Food: Dry kibble is convenient and cost-effective, while wet food is easier to eat and digest for some puppies.
- Protein Source Matters: Salmon and lamb are common alternatives for sensitive puppies, while some formulas avoid chicken or common allergens.
- Bag Size Options: Small bags are ideal for trials or small breeds, mid-size for single-pet homes, and large bags for value or multi-pet households.
- Digestive Support Ingredients: Look for prebiotics, probiotics, and easily digestible grains like rice or oat meal.
- Breed-Specific Needs: Large breed puppies may require formulas tailored for steady growth and joint health.
- Transparency and Labeling: Some brands clearly state protein percentages and ingredient sourcing, which can help owners make informed choices.
- Common Misunderstandings: Not all sensitive formulas are grain-free, and not all puppies need the same protein source. Wet food is not always better for sensitive stomachs—digestibility and ingredient quality matter most.
Dry Kibble vs. Wet Food for Sensitive Puppies
Puppies with sensitive stomachs may do better on either dry or wet food, depending on their chewing ability and digestive health. Wet food can be gentler for very young or picky eaters, while dry kibble is often more practical for daily feeding.
- Wet food: Easier to chew and digest, but requires refrigeration after opening and can be more expensive.
- Dry kibble: Convenient and shelf-stable, but may be harder for some puppies to eat if they have dental issues.
Choosing the Right Protein Source
Sensitive puppies often benefit from alternative proteins like salmon or lamb. These proteins are less likely to cause reactions compared to chicken or beef.
- Salmon-based formulas: Popular for skin and coat health, and generally well-tolerated.
- Lamb-based options: Good for puppies with multiple sensitivities or those avoiding poultry.
- Check for allergen-free labeling: Some formulas exclude corn, wheat, soy, or artificial colors.
Bag Size and Value Considerations
Bag size impacts cost, storage, and freshness. Small bags are best for trying new foods or feeding small breeds, while larger bags offer better value for bigger puppies or multi-pet homes.
- Small bags: Less risk if your puppy rejects the food.
- Large bags: Lower cost per meal, but require more storage space.
- Mid-size bags: Good balance for single-pet households.
Digestive and Skin Support Ingredients
Look for foods with added prebiotics, probiotics, and omega fatty acids. These support gut health and help maintain a healthy coat, which is important for sensitive puppies.
- Prebiotic fiber: Supports beneficial gut bacteria.
- Omega-6 and vitamin E: Promote skin and coat health.
- Easily digestible grains: Rice and oat meal are gentler than corn or wheat.
